Abstract

The invention provides a management system and a method of an intelligent household appliance and a Bluetooth gateway, comprising the following steps: the mobile terminal is used for acquiring linkage information and a management instruction input by a user, determining whether connection can be established with the Bluetooth gateway through Bluetooth or not, if so, sending the linkage information and the management instruction to the Bluetooth gateway through the Bluetooth, and otherwise, sending the linkage information and the management instruction to the cloud server through a wireless network so that the cloud server forwards the linkage information and the management instruction to the Bluetooth gateway; and the Bluetooth gateway is used for receiving the linkage information and the management instruction, storing the linkage information, determining whether the cooperative intelligent household appliances which work in cooperation with the target intelligent household appliance indicated by the management instruction exist according to the linkage information and the management instruction, if so, managing the cooperative intelligent household appliances according to the management instruction and the cooperative linkage information associated with the cooperative intelligent household appliances in the linkage information, and otherwise, managing the target intelligent household appliances according to the management instruction. The scheme can realize cooperative work among the devices.

In the embodiment of the invention, in order to facilitate a user to know the operation state of each intelligent household appliance, the bluetooth gateway can acquire the operation information (such as the current operation parameters of the intelligent household appliance) of each intelligent household appliances, and send the operation information to the mobile terminal through bluetooth, or send the operation information to the cloud server through a wireless network, and then forward the operation information to the mobile terminal.
For example, the linkage information stored by the bluetooth gateway is: the temperature in the refrigerating chamber of the 'refrigerator' is abnormal when the temperature is higher than 12 ℃;
the running information that the bluetooth gateway obtained from intelligent household electrical appliances "refrigerator" is: the current operating parameter in the freezer is 15 °;
according to the information, the current running state of the refrigerator is abnormal, so that the temperature abnormality of the refrigerating chamber of the refrigerator can be sent to the mobile terminal as warning information through Bluetooth, or sent to the cloud server through a wireless network, and then forwarded to the mobile terminal.
For example, the temperature sensor with the bluetooth communication function collects the temperature of the current environment, when the temperature is higher than 28 degrees (the linkage information set by the user through the mobile terminal), the wireless intelligent air conditioner is directly controlled through the bluetooth gateway (the air conditioner is turned on and set to a cooling mode), and when the ambient temperature is kept for two hours at 26 degrees after being cooled (the linkage information set by the user through the mobile terminal), the wireless intelligent air conditioner is controlled through the bluetooth gateway (the air conditioner is turned off). The scene avoids manual participation, and solves the problem that the household appliances cannot work cooperatively in the background technology of the invention.
Specifically, the Bluetooth household appliances connected with the Bluetooth gateway all support the communication protocol, and the Bluetooth household appliances governed by the Bluetooth network and the wireless household appliances form a Mesh network.
It should be noted that, when the mobile terminal APP sets the routing information for the bluetooth gateway for the first time, the mobile terminal APP sends data in the conventional wireless communication manner, and may also establish connection with the bluetooth gateway through the GATT technology and transmit data through the BLE technology.

As shown in fig. 2, in order to more clearly illustrate the technical solutions and advantages of the present invention, the following takes the intelligent household appliances as a "range hood" having a bluetooth communication function, a "refrigerator" having a bluetooth communication function, and a "dishwasher" having an infinite communication function, and takes the mobile terminal as a "smart phone", the target intelligent household appliance is a "range hood", and the intelligent household appliance is a "dishwasher" in cooperation, to describe in detail the management system of the intelligent household appliance provided by the present invention, which specifically includes:
the system comprises a cloud server 201, a smart phone 202, a Bluetooth gateway 203, a dishwasher 204, a refrigerator 205 and a range hood 206;
the smart phone 202 is configured to obtain linkage information and a management instruction input by a user, determine whether a connection can be established with the bluetooth gateway 203 through bluetooth, send the linkage information and the management instruction to the bluetooth gateway 203 through bluetooth if the connection can be established with the bluetooth gateway 203 through bluetooth, and send the linkage information and the management instruction to the cloud server 201 through a wireless network if the connection can not be established with the bluetooth gateway.
Specifically, the smart phone can be preferentially sent to the smart phone through the Bluetooth when acquiring the management instruction input by the user and used for managing and controlling the dish washing machine, the linkage information of the refrigerator and the range hood during cooperative work and controlling the range hood, excessive network resources are occupied when interaction between devices is avoided, when the interaction with the smart phone cannot be directly conducted through the Bluetooth, in order to guarantee that the control requirement of the user on the range hood is met, the linkage information and the management instruction can be sent to the cloud server through a wireless network, and then the cloud server forwards the linkage information and the management instruction to the Bluetooth gateway.
And the cloud server 201 is used for sending the linkage information and the management instruction to the Bluetooth gateway 203 when receiving the linkage information and the management instruction used for indicating the range hood 206.
The bluetooth gateway 203 is configured to store the linkage information when receiving the linkage information and the management instruction sent by the bluetooth gateway 203 or the cloud server 201, determine whether a cooperative intelligent appliance cooperating with the range hood exists in each intelligent appliance according to the stored linkage information and the management instruction, manage the dishwasher 204 according to the management instruction and the cooperative linkage information associated with the dishwasher 204 in the linkage information when the dishwasher 204 cooperating with the range hood exists, and otherwise, manage the range hood 206 according to the management instruction.
Specifically, after receiving the linkage information, the bluetooth gateway needs to store the linkage information, so that the monitoring and control device of the household appliance can work cooperatively based on the linkage information in the following process. After the management instruction is received, the range hood with the Bluetooth function is controlled by the management instruction, so that the range hood needs to be controlled through Bluetooth according to the management instruction, and then when the dishwasher working in cooperation with the range hood is determined to exist through linkage information and the management instruction, the dishwasher is managed and controlled through a wireless network according to the cooperation linkage information associated with the dishwasher in the linkage information.
For example, the linkage information is: when the oil absorption gear of the range hood is 1 gear, the wind power is 1 level, and the washing mode of the dish washing machine is a; when the oil suction gear of the range hood is 2, the wind power is 2, the washing mode of the dish washing machine is b, the temperature of the freezing chamber of the refrigerator is-14 degrees, and the temperature of the refrigerating chamber is-3 degrees.
The management command is used for controlling the range hood to adjust to the 1 st gear.
The bluetooth gateway 203 adjusts the range hood to 1 st gear through bluetooth according to the management instruction, and then adjusts the washing mode of the dishwasher 204 to a through the wireless network.
A bluetooth gateway 203 for performing:
a: the running information of the range hood and the refrigerator 205 is obtained through Bluetooth, the running information of the dish washing machine is obtained through a wireless network, and whether abnormal household appliances run abnormally in each dish washing machine, the refrigerator 205 and the range hood is determined according to the linkage information and the running information.
Specifically, in order to facilitate a user to know the operating states of the dish washing machine, the refrigerator and the range hood, the Bluetooth gateway communicates according to the communication functions of different devices to acquire relevant operating information, and then judges the operating states of the oil suction machine, the refrigerator and the dish washing machine based on the acquired operating information and linkage information to determine whether each device normally operates.
For example, the state of obtaining the range hood through bluetooth is "on", the oil absorption gear is 1 shelves, and wind-force is 2 grades. The operation information of the refrigerator is acquired through Bluetooth and is ' freezing chamber-5 degrees ' and refrigerating chamber 3 degrees ', and the washing mode of the dishwasher is acquired through a wireless network and is a.
B: and when the abnormal household appliance exists, determining whether the connection with the mobile terminal can be established through Bluetooth, if so, executing C, otherwise, executing D.
C: the running information and the warning information used for indicating the abnormal running of the abnormal household appliance are sent to the mobile terminal through the Bluetooth;
d: the running information is sent to the cloud server 201 through the wireless network, so that the cloud server 201 forwards the running information to the mobile terminal.
Specifically, since the linkage information includes different information corresponding to different devices, it can be determined whether the intelligent appliance is abnormal through the coordinated linkage information corresponding to different intelligent appliances and the operation information of each appliance. For example, the linkage information obtained through the bluetooth gateway: when the oil absorption gear of the range hood is 1 gear, the wind power is 1 level; when range hood's oil absorption gear is 2 shelves, wind-force is 2 grades, the freezer temperature of refrigerator is-14, the freezer temperature of freezer is-3, can judge with the running information of each household electrical appliances that the bluetooth gateway acquireed, range hood and dish washer normal operation, the freezer operation of refrigerator is unusual, therefore, the bluetooth gateway can send the running information who acquires and the information that is used for instructing refrigerator freezer operation anomaly for the smart mobile phone through the bluetooth, perhaps send for the high in the clouds server through wireless network, then forward for mobile terminal through the high in the clouds server.
